In publisher's original plastic wrappers. Without DJ, as issued. Presents John Patrick Salisbury's "Drew And Jimmy". His photo-poem to his brother, Burton, who died at the age of nineteen. John Patrick and Burton grew up on Walnut Grove along the Sacramento River Delta. As he describes it, their sibling relationship was one of ferocious rivalry and fraternal love, brotherhood as a unique kind of friendship that, in their case, was tragically cut short by youthful death. To memorialize this friendship and the place in which it took place, Salisbury photographed their younger cousins, Drew and Jimmy, over the years, brothers who are "stand-ins" (there is no other word) for himself and his dead brother. Drew and Jimmy are photographed first as good-looking kids and then without a break, as handsome, full-grown teen-agers, against the same, unchanging Edenic backdrop. The photographs are redolent of American Pastoral, the innocence and purity of rural life that are celebrated by the great (and now-vanished) American tradition in literature and art. Salisbury's subdued and non-sensationalistic photographs have a lyrical beauty rarely found in contemporary photography. A journey into The Past as only the best photographs can sometimes render.
